The #ChildcareSubsidySpecialApproval program does not automatically apply to all families. It requires a special approval process, hence the name. The process begins with the family submitting an application to the relevant department or agency. The application typically includes documentation proving the family’s income level and special circumstances that make them eligible for the subsidy. The review process for the #ChildcareSubsidySpecialApproval varies by jurisdiction, but it generally involves a thorough examination of the family’s financial situation and the child’s needs. The reviewing agency may request additional documentation or conduct interviews with the family to ensure they meet the program’s eligibility requirements. Once the review process is complete, the agency will decide whether or not to grant the family special approval for the childcare subsidy. If approved, the family will receive a subsidy amount that varies based on their income level, the child’s needs, and other factors. The subsidy can significantly reduce the family’s out-of-pocket childcare expenses, making quality care more affordable and accessible. However, it is crucial to remember that receiving #ChildcareSubsidySpecialApproval is not a one-time process. Most programs require families to reapply for the subsidy periodically, typically every year, to ensure they still meet the eligibility requirements. During the reapplication process, families may need to provide updated financial information and proof of continued need for the subsidy.
